The Calorie Spectrum in a Pint of Cookies and Cream
Cookies and cream is a popular ice cream flavor, but the number of calories in a pint can be surprising. A pint, which is 16 fluid ounces, is often seen as a single serving. However, the calorie count can be substantial. A full-fat premium brand might contain more than 1,000 calories per pint. A light or low-calorie brand could be as low as 300. This difference is primarily due to the variations in fat, sugar, and ingredients. The volume of a pint also contributes to the total, as it can hold multiple standard servings.
Factors Affecting Calorie Counts
Several factors determine the calorie count of a pint of cookies and cream ice cream. Understanding these factors helps consumers gauge the nutritional impact of their choice.
Brand and Ingredient Quality
Different brands use different formulas, leading to significant calorie differences. Premium ice creams often use more cream and a higher percentage of milk fat. This results in a richer texture and a higher calorie count per serving. Light ice creams replace some or all of the fat and sugar with low-calorie alternatives and artificial sweeteners.
- Premium brands: Tend to be higher in fat and sugar, resulting in a higher calorie count per pint.
- Light brands: Use low-fat milk and sugar substitutes to reduce total calories. Halo Top is known for its low-calorie pints.
- Store brands: Can vary in quality and ingredients. Checking the nutritional label is crucial.
Full-Fat vs. Light Ice Cream
The difference between regular and light ice cream comes down to the ingredients used. Regular ice cream uses a higher percentage of butterfat and sugar to create its creaminess. Light versions use less fat, sometimes replacing it with milk solids, and may use non-nutritive sweeteners to reduce calories. This process can alter the mouthfeel and flavor, but low-calorie alternatives are palatable.
Add-ins and Inclusions
Beyond the base ice cream, any additional mix-ins, like extra cookie dough or fudge swirls, will add to the total calorie count. A pint with large cookie chunks and a rich vanilla base will have more calories than a version with smaller, sparse pieces.
Comparing Cookies and Cream Pints
The following is a comparison of different types of cookies and cream ice cream pints based on available nutritional information. Exact values can vary based on brand.
| Brand Type | Calorie Range (per pint) | Primary Fat Source | Key Difference | Example Brand |
|---|---|---|---|---|
| Premium | 1,000+ kcal | Heavy Cream | High fat, dense texture | Häagen-Dazs, Ben & Jerry's |
| Standard/Store | 600–800 kcal | Cream, Milk Fat | Balanced fat/sugar, mainstream | Breyers, Turkey Hill |
| Light/Low-Calorie | 300–400 kcal | Skim Milk | Reduced fat, often sugar substitutes | Halo Top |
| Homemade | 800–1200+ kcal | Cream, Condensed Milk | Varies based on recipe and ingredients | N/A |
| Thrifty | 580 kcal | Cream, Milk Fat | Specific brand example | Thrifty |
Managing Ice Cream Consumption
If you want to enjoy cookies and cream while managing your calorie intake, consider these tips:
- Read the nutrition label: Check the 'calories per serving' and 'servings per container'. Don't assume a low calorie per serving means the pint is low in total calories.
- Practice portion control: A pint is a large quantity. Measure out a single serving (typically 2/3 cup).
- Explore low-calorie alternatives: Brands like Halo Top offer a cookies and cream flavor with fewer calories, making it a viable option.
- Balance your diet: Incorporate the ice cream into your overall daily calorie budget. Adjust other meals accordingly.
